Job Description:

  • Assist Safety Manager on all safety, health, environmental, and welfare matters to ensure the Project complies with statutory obligations, safety requirements, and aerodrome safety standards.
  • Be responsible for health, safety, and environmental control, and assist Safety Manager to ensure all works adhere to procedures and instructions.
  • Assist Safety Manager in liaising and coordinating with stakeholders, authorities, agencies, and other Consultants employed by Developer.
  • Put up daily situation reports.
  • Ensure risk assessment and safe working procedures are correctly executed on site.
  • Conduct daily health, safety, and environmental inspections, prepare reports and follow up with Project Safety Team / Contractors for closure.
  • Carry out investigations into all accidents and near‐miss incidents and record findings on relevant forms.
  • Wear appropriate personal protective clothing/equipment and observe all safety requirements/procedures.
  • Implement and monitor appropriate safety measures in accordance with the Workplace Health and Safety Act and Safety Management System.
  • Highlight areas where training/certification is required to meet standards imposed by legislation, approved codes of practice, or H.S.E. guidance.

Job Requirement:

  • At least 3 years relevant experience in the construction industry, preferably 2 years with the developer/main contractor.
  • Must be a registered Workplace Safety and Health Officer with MOM.
  • Has developed a Risk Management Implementation Plan (bizSAFE Level 2) or equivalent.
